About Quench
Quench USA, Inc. offers bottle-free filtered water solutions for healthy and environmentally conscious consumers outside the home, through direct sales and independent dealers across North America. Our bottle-free water coolers, ice machines, sparkling water dispensers and coffee brewers, purify the existing water supply to provide reliable and convenient filtered water to a broad mix of businesses, including government, education, healthcare, manufacturing, retail, hospitality, and other large commercial customers, including more than half of the Fortune 500. Quench has grown from a small regional company to a national and international leader that had a successful NYSE public offering in 2016 and is now a strategic company owned by private equity backed Culligan. The Company has a sustainable mission and value proposition and is the leading consolidator in a fast-growing market. Headquartered in King of Prussia, PA, Quench has sales and service operations across North America to serve our 60,000+ customers, and a network of over 250 independent dealers selling products under the brand names Pure Water Technology, Wellsys and Bluline. About Culligan
Founded by Emmett Culligan in 1936, Culligan is a world leader in delivering superior water solutions that will make a real difference in improving the health and wellness of consumers. The company offers some of the most technologically advanced, state-of-the-art water filtration and treatment products. These products include water softeners, drinking water systems, whole-house systems, and solutions for businesses. Culligan's network of franchise dealers is the largest in the world, with over 900 dealers in 90 countries.
